Reaction
The enzyme uses maltooligosaccharides as donor and acceptor substrates. It cleaves alpha1->4 glucosidic bonds and synthesizes 1->6 and 1->4 glucosidic linkages. =

Crystallization
Crystallization on EC 2.4.1.B34 - 4,6-alpha-glucanotransferase

purified recombinant wild-type enzyme in apoform and in complex with maltohexaose, and enzyme mutant D1015N in complex with maltopentaose, crystallized by the hanging-drop vapor diffusion method and a microseeding protocol, X-ray diffraction structre determination and analysis at 1.80-2.19 A resolution, molecular replacement using domains A, B, C, and IV of the crystal structure of Lactobacillus reuteri 180 GTF180-DELTAN (PDB ID 3KLK) as a search model
